Resolving Connection Failures

The error message “You were kicked from the game (VerifySignatures failed)” is the most frequent technical hurdle encountered by DayZ modded community servers. This security trigger indicates a cryptographic handshake failure between the player’s client and the server’s security registry. It typically results from a version mismatch, a missing authentication key, or local file corruption. Resolving this issue promptly is essential for maintaining your server’s accessibility and player retention.

Technical Root Causes

Understanding why the engine is rejecting a connection is the first step toward a permanent fix.
  • Missing Security Keys: The server possesses the mod files but lacks the corresponding .bikey within the central /keys/ registry.
  • Asynchronous Updates: A modification was updated on the Steam Workshop, but your server is still executing an older cached version.
  • Client Corruption: A specific player’s local mod download has become corrupted or contains unauthorized localized files.

Administrator’s Resolution Checklist

Follow these steps to ensure your server’s security perimeter is correctly configured.
1

Audit Your Keys

For every modification listed in your -mod= startup parameter, verify that its unique .bikey file is present in the server’s root /keys/ directory.
2

Synchronize with Steam

3

Re-Copy Key Files

Following a major mod update, the author may change the name of the key file. Always navigate to the mod’s internal Keys folder and re-copy the .bikey to your server’s root /keys/ directory after a patch.

Diagnostic Triage

If the error persists, use this logic to determine if the issue is global or isolated.
If every player is being disconnected with the same error, the issue is strictly server-side. Focus your efforts on verifying your /keys/ directory and ensuring your mod load order is correct.
